Abstract

A principle of construction of search algorithms on local segments of a raster area with the use of graphic images of functional voxel modeling is discussed. An algorithm for constructing gradient lines to organize rules for local search of points is given. A principle of generation of M-images for graphical representation of search control parameters is presented. Examples of the work of the local search gradient algorithm to fill a bounded fragment of a raster area of a specified point are given.
